DLL (Dynamic Link Library) files are essential components of many computer programs and systems. They contain code and data that multiple programs can use at the same time, helping to improve efficiency and conserve memory. One such DLL file is NHibernate.XmlSerializers.dll, which is related to the NHibernate framework used in software development.
However, users may encounter issues with this file, such as errors during installation or missing file notifications. Understanding this DLL file and its potential problems is crucial for maintaining a smoothly running computer system.

Common Issues and Errors Related to NHibernate.XmlSerializers.dll
DLL files, fundamental to our systems, can sometimes lead to unexpected errors. Here, we provide an overview of the most frequently encountered DLL-related errors.
- NHibernate.XmlSerializers.dll Access Violation: This points to a situation where a process has attempted to interact with NHibernate.XmlSerializers.dll in a way that violates system or application rules. This might be due to incorrect programming, memory overflows, or the running process lacking necessary permissions.
- NHibernate.XmlSerializers.dll could not be loaded: This error indicates that the DLL file, necessary for certain operations, couldn't be loaded by the system. Potential causes might include missing DLL files, DLL files that are not properly registered in the system, or conflicts with other software.
- This application failed to start because NHibernate.XmlSerializers.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error is thrown when a necessary DLL file is not found by the application. It might have been accidentally deleted or misplaced. Reinstallation of the application can possibly resolve this issue by replacing the missing DLL file.
- Cannot register NHibernate.XmlSerializers.dll: This error is indicative of the system's inability to correctly register the DLL file. This might occur due to issues with the Windows Registry or because the DLL file itself is corrupt or improperly installed.
- The file NHibernate.XmlSerializers.dll is missing: The error indicates that the DLL file, essential for the proper function of an application or the system itself, is not located in its expected directory.
